Exactly How Turbocharging Functions
While many contemporary engines go for performance and power, turbocharging stands apart as a crucial modern technology that enhances performance without significantly boosting engine dimension. Turbocharging jobs by making use of exhaust gases to spin a turbine connected to a compressor. As the wind turbine spins, it attracts in even more air right into the engine's burning chamber. This rise in air enables a greater fuel-to-air proportion, resulting in more efficient combustion (Ford Fiesta Ecoboost). The compact design of the turbocharger enables it to fit perfectly within engine designs, offering a boost in power without adding considerable weight. By taking advantage of energy that would otherwise be squandered, turbocharging optimizes engine performance, ensuring that vehicle drivers experience boosted velocity and responsiveness when required

Performance Turbo vs. Naturally Aspirated
The dispute in between turbocharged and normally aspirated engines centers on performance dynamics and engine effectiveness - Ford Fiesta Ecoboost. Turbocharged engines make use of a turbine-driven forced induction system, allowing for enhanced air consumption and better power result from smaller sized displacement. This results in improved fuel effectiveness and improved velocity. Alternatively, normally aspirated engines count solely on atmospheric pressure, creating power without extra air compression. While they commonly supply an even more straight power contour and give prompt throttle response, they might do not have the raw power possible located in turbocharged equivalents. Inevitably, the selection between both systems relies on driving preferences, with turbocharged engines appealing to those seeking efficiency and performance, while normally aspirated engines bring in lovers that favor simplicity and responsiveness
